Abstract
Abstract The synthesis of various substituted 6-vinyl-1, 2-dihydro-2-oxo-3-pyridinecarboxylic acids from the dianions of 1, 2-dihydro-6-methyl-2-oxo-3-pyridinecarbonitrile and the corresponding 3-t-butyl ester is reported. The dianions were generated with LDA in THF at low temperature and reacted with various carbonyl substrates. Several conditions for the dehydration and hydrolysis of these adducts to the vinyl pyridone acids are discussed. ...
